Homosassa, FL Radon Mitigation and Testing
This Citrus County community (34446) in the Homosassa Springs Metro sits in EPA Zone 2, reflecting moderate radon potential from Florida's limestone bedrock and phosphate-bearing formations. Testing data is currently limited for this specific area, making individual home assessment particularly valuable for residents. The area's mix of older homes and newer developments on varying foundation types can create different radon entry pathways requiring property-specific evaluation.

Homosassa Radon Facts
Key details about the radon risk profile for Homosassa and the 34446 zip code area.
Homosassa and the 34446 zip code are located in Citrus County, which has an EPA assigned Radon Zone of 2. A radon zone of 2 predicts an average indoor radon screening level between 2 and 4 pCi/L. The EPA recommends testing every home regardless of zone classification.
